Construction Site Land Clearing in Houston, TX

Construction site land clearing services involve removing trees, shrubs, debris, and other obstacles to prepare a property for development or landscaping projects. This service is commonly requested for new construction, home additions, backyard renovations, or establishing clear space for driveways, gardens, or recreational areas. Property owners should consider the size and type of vegetation, as well as any underground utilities or structures, before requesting land clearing to ensure the process aligns with their project goals.

Homeowners typically want to understand the scope of clearing needed, including whether it involves only surface debris removal or complete tree and shrub removal. It’s also important to assess property access, potential permits, and the impact on the landscape. Clear communication about the desired outcome can help ensure the land is properly prepared for the next phase of development or landscaping, making the process smoother and more efficient.

Project Types

Common Construction Site Land Clearing Jobs

Residential land clearing - prepares yards for new landscaping, construction, or outdoor projects.

Commercial site clearing - removes trees, shrubs, and debris to make way for development or renovations.

Tree and brush removal - clears overgrown areas to improve safety and accessibility on the property.

Stump grinding and removal - eliminates remaining tree stumps to create a smooth, functional surface.

Lot leveling and grading - ensures proper drainage and a stable foundation for building projects.

Debris and waste removal - clears away cleared materials to leave the site clean and ready for use.

FAQ

Construction Site Land Clearing Questions

What is site land clearing? Site land clearing involves removing trees, brush, and debris to prepare a property for construction or development projects.

Why is land clearing important before construction? Clearing the land ensures a safe, level area for building foundations and helps prevent issues like drainage problems or obstructions.

What types of projects typically require land clearing? Projects such as residential developments, commercial buildings, or property expansions often need land clearing to create suitable spaces.

How does land clearing impact property preparation? It provides a clean, accessible site that meets the requirements for grading, foundation work, and future landscaping.
